The 68th Annual GRAMMY Awards are officially going down tonight in Los Angeles, and many of our faves are nominated, and the wins are being announced!

Durand Bernarr officially took home his first GRAMMY Award tonight, winning Best Progressive R&B Album for his beautifully layered, deeply intentional project BLOOM at the Grammy Awards — and honestly? About time.

If you’ve been paying attention, Durand has been quietly (and sometimes loudly) building one of the most authentic, boundary-pushing bodies of work in modern R&B. BLOOM wasn’t just an album — it was a statement. A love letter to growth, connection, vulnerability, and community.

The born and raised Cleveland, Ohio native has been a fixture in the music world for years — from background vocals, noteworthy collaborations, and captivating live performances while building a following of his own.

The 2025 album commanded audiences, and tonight it was honored with the Best Progressive R&B Album award. Durand’s beat out an incredible group of artists, including Bilal (Adjust Brightness), Destin Conrad (LOVE ON DIGITAL), FLO (Access All Areas), and Terrace Martin & Kenyon Dixon (Come As You Are).
